Patented June 16, 1942 VEGETABLE CLEANER Joseph 'Thomas,'Walnut Grove, alif., assignor to Food Machinery Corporation, San Jose, Caliih, a corporation of Delaware Application ,June16, 1938, Serial No. 212,053
24 Claims.
This invention relates to vegetable cleaning apparatus, and, although susceptible of more or less general application to a wide variety of products, is especiallywell suited for cleaning asparagus, and hence, for purposesof this disclosure, will be described as it may be used in that connection.
As is well known, the cleaning of asparagus for commercial purposes presents aparticularly difficult problem by reason -of the tenderness of the stalks which necessitates careful handling to avoid injury, and such methods of cleaning as have heretofore been employed are generally ineffective to accomplish thorough cleaning, as well as beingslow and unsuited to modern production requirements.
It is the general" object of the present invention to provide a vegetable cleaning machine which is capable of effecting a thorough cleaning of the vegetables without injuriouslyrough treatment thereof.
A more specific object is to provide a-machine which iswell adaptedfor cleaning asparagus effectively and without injury. thereto.
Another object is to provide a vegetable cleaning machine of the character referred to, which is continuous in operation,'has a large capacity, and is of simple and. inexpensive construction.
Further objectsand'advantages will best be understood from the following description of an illustrative embodiment taken in connection-with the accompanying drawing thereof, inwhich:
Fig. 1 is a longitudinal sectional elevation of a machine embodying the-invention, as viewed along the line l--l of-Fig..2.
Fig. 2 is a plan view of the machine.
In the drawing, the reference character indicates an open topped tank within the upper portion of which are mounted two sets of, parallel, transversely extending cylindrical bru'sh rolls, namely, an upper setgenerally indicatedat 2 and a lower set generally indicated at 3. Preferably, for cleaning asparagus, the brush bristles are formed of horsehair or other similarly soft material, although for cleaning other products, bristles of'greater or lesserstifiness maybe used according-to the nature and requirements of the particular product to be cleaned. All of the brushes are rotatably mounted bymeans of the brush shafts 4 which project through the side walls of the tank, theupper brush shafts being journalled, in bearings 5 carried by side rails 6 secured totheoutside of ,the tank, and the lower brush shafts being journalled' in bearings 1 carried by side rails 8 extending parallel to and beneath the rails 6.
The brushes of the upper set, indicated at 9, I0 and II respectively, are arranged with their peripheries in closely adjacent relation, and are driven from a drive shaft I2 journalled in bearings I3 carried by a supporting framework l4 mounted to one side of thetank l. Thedrive shaft i2 is provided with a pulleyv l5 which may be driven from any suitable source of power, and carries a series of bevel gears I6, H and I8 which intermesh respectively with corresponding bevel gears I9, 20 and 2| secured to the outer ends of the upper brush shafts.
The brushes 22 and 23 of the lower set are arranged beneath the valleys formed between the brushes of the upper setand are driven by chains 24 and 25 respectively. The chain 24 is trained around a pair. of sprockets 26 carried respectively by the shaft of the upper brush 9 and lower brush 22. The chain 25 is trained around the sprockets 21 carried by the shafts of the upper brush II and lower brush 23.
It is to be observed that the ratios and arrangement of the associated pairs of bevel gears l 6-l 9, I'l-ZB, and l82l are such that the first two brushes 9 and ID of the upper set are driven in a clockwise direction as viewed in Fig. 1, but that the brush I [I is driven at a slowerv speed thanthe brush 9. The final brush 1 l is driven in an anticlockwise direction, and preferably at a higher rate of speed than the middle brush I 0. The two brushes 22 and 23 of the lower set are driven in opposite directions so that their upper peripheries move towards each other, and may be driven at the same speeds. I have found that with upper brushes of 5" diametereach and lower brushes of 6" diameter each, rotative speeds of 400 R. P. M., R. P. M., and 400 R. P. M., respectively for the upper brushes 9, l0 and II, and 400 R. P. M. for each of the lower. brushes, gives satisfactory results for cleaning asparagus, but it is to be understood that these particular speeds are given as illustrative examples only and may be varied according to preference, conditions of operation, or to suit the requirements of the par.- ticular product to be cleaned.
In operation, the asparagus to be cleaned is indiscriminately spread, although preferably not too deeply, upon the feed conveyor 21, which disone of the spray pipes 39 which extend above the valleys between the brushes. Water may be supplied to the spray pipes from any suitable source through the header 3|. The wash water is collected in the lower part of the tank I provided with an outlet 32 from which the water may be discharged to the sewer, or if desired, pumped back to the spray pipes for re-use.
It will be apparent that although the first two brushes 9 and Ill are driven in a common direction of rotation, the speed difierential between them causes the asparagus in the bottom of the valley to be urged downwardly between the brushes, due to the greater speed of the downwardly travelling periphery of the brush 9 than;
that of the adjacent upwardly travelling periphery of the brush l9 and the length of the bristles relative to the size of the asparagus is such as to permit the product to be positively discharged downwardly through the valley. On the other hand, if the asparagus is delivered in suflicient quantities, it will not only pile up in the valley between the brushes to a certain extent depending upon the rate of feed, but many of the stalks will inevitably be deposited crosswise of the brushes, and the common direction of rotation of the brushes causes these crosswise stalks, together with those piled on top of them and those which by reason of their position in the pile are more greatly affected by the brush l than the brush 9, to advance over the crest of the brush l0 into the next succeeding valley. The result is that in operation a portion of the asparagus delivered into the valley between the first two brushes is positively discharged downwardly between the brushes while the rest advances over the middle brush into the next valley.
The asparagus reaching the valley between the brushes l0 and II ishowever subjected to the action of oppositely rotating brushes, and the brush H not only opposes further advance of the asparagus, but does so with greater force than the brush l0 tends to advance it, due to its higher rate of speed. Moreover, the downwardly moving adjacent peripheries of the brushes cooperate to urge the asparagus downwardly between them, with the result that all of the asparagus delivered into the valley between the rolls l0 and l l is positively discharged downwardly between them.
The stalks of asparagus discharged downwardly between the brush rolls of the upper set fall upon the upper surfaces of the oppositely rotating pair of lower brushes as will be apparent, and is moved by these latter brushes into the valley between them where it receives further brushing. The staggered relation of the lower brushes with respect to the upper ones permits them to be mounted as illustrated for cooperation with the upper intermediate brush to form passageways 33, through which the asparagus passes in brushing engagement with the adjacent faces of the rolls forming the passageways. This arrangement provides added brushing action and also causes a slight bending action on the stalks as they pass into and out of the passageways which increases the brushing action on the stalks as they pass to the valley between the lower brushes. From the latter valley the asparagus is discharged downwardly under the action of the adjacent downwardly moving brush peripheries.
As heretofore pointed out, these lower brushes are somewhat larger than those of the upper set so that although they are set closely together, their axes are offset from beneath the valleys between the upper brushes. With this arrangement, the asparagus does not fall directly upon the crests of the lower brushes, but slightly over toward the valley between them, which insures a proper and positive feed to the latter valley. Moreover, the paths from the valleys between the upper brushes to the valley between the lower ones makes a less abrubt turn than would be the case if smaller brushes were used, thereby minimizing danger of bending the stalks to the point of breaking them as they are transferred from the upper valleys to the lower one.
The asparagus discharged from the lower brushes may be received upon an endless conveyor 34 which carries it out of the tank to any suitable point of discharge.
It will be seen that the asparagus receives a thorough brushing during its passage through the machine, first by the upper brushes, again as it passes between the upper, middle brush and the cooperating faces of the lower brushes, and finally by the lower brushes as it passes into and downwardly through the valley between them. During the brushing treatment it is also thoroughly washed so that it is effectively cleaned by the time it reaches the discharge conveyor.
It may be observed that although, in the particular embodiment selected for illustration, the upper set of brushes employs three brushes, and the lower set two, a greater or lesser number may be employed if desired. For example, additional brushes such as 9 and I0 might be placed ahead of them and additional sets of lower brushes be arranged to cooperate therewith. Or, if a smaller machine or less brushing be desired, the brush 9 may be dispensed with, or both the brush 9 and 22 be eliminated. Obviously, if only the brush 9 is omitted the machine will have less capacity but the asparagus will receive substantially the same amount of treatment. On the other hand, if both the brushes 9 and 22 be omitted, the capacity of the machine will not only be reduced but the asparagus will receive somewhat less treatments.
Modifications such as just referred to may be desirable forcertain conditions or purposes, and it will be understood that these and other variations in arrangement as well as various modifications and alterations in structure may be made without in any way departing from the spirit or scope of my invention. Moreover, it will also be understood that although I have described the invention as it may be used in connection with the cleaning of asparagus, it may likewise be used for cleaning other vegetables or articles as well, and I deem myself entitled to all such uses, arrangements, modifications and alterations.
